mdaan, here are a couple of pointers to answer your question: 1. full manual focus 2. don't be greedy, move in slowly and focus as you go - otw you can easily lose your bearing as you close in on your subject 3. breathe! apply what the SAF taught you ![]() 4. keep finger on shutter release, half-press (its MF anyway so no issue) 5. when the moment is right, your intended part of the macro subject is in focus, shoot. weight is not an issue, with some practice ![]() unless you're crazy enough like me to try the bellows for insect macros

hahahaha... tummy in the way eh? not to worry bro, you're not alone, i've nearly passed out on a few occasions crunching for a low-angle shot, and could not breathe. the shallow DOF even at f8 is a pain... next time we shd bring along mats/ newspaper to lie down or small foldable stools to sit on iso squatting. otw, one quick fix is a wider stance, stabilize legs first before moving in. i dunno if i was aching on sat night from hauling the 400mm around or from macro though i suspect the latter haha.. |
